Abstract :
The authors consider the application of power system stabilisers via the turbine governors of generating units in a multimachine power system. This arrangement is called a governor power system stabiliser (GPSS). The design is based on the principle of phase compensation and is easier than with conventional stabilisers. The authors present results of analysis and simulation of a three-machine system, which show that GPSS may be used to suppress low-frequency oscillations and improve stability
